HTML 기본 구조와 태그 종류 정리






HTML 기본 구조 및 태그 종류 안내

HTML 기본 구조 및 태그 종류 안내

웹 개발의 기초에서 HTML은 필수적인 요소로, 이를 통해 우리는 웹 페이지를 만들고 그 내용을 구조적으로 표현할 수 있습니다. HTML은 ‘Hyper Text Markup Language’의 약자로, 웹 페이지에서 정보를 구조화하고 스타일링을 가능하게 하는 마크업 언어입니다. 이 글에서는 HTML의 기본 구조와 다양한 태그의 종류에 대하여 알아보도록 하겠습니다.

HTML의 기본 구조

HTML 문서는 다음과 같은 기본 형식을 가지고 있습니다:

  • <!DOCTYPE html> : HTML5 문서를 정의하는 선언문
  • <html> : HTML 문서의 시작 태그
  • <head> : 문서의 메타데이터와 스타일, 스크립트를 포함
  • <body> : 사용자에게 보여질 내용을 포함

HTML 문서는 다음과 같은 형태를 띠고 있습니다:

<!DOCTYPE html>
<html lang="ko">
  <head>
    <meta charset="UTF-8">
    <title>웹 페이지 제목</title>
  </head>
  <body>
    <h1>안녕하세요!</h1>
    <p>이곳은 HTML 문서입니다.</p>
  </body>
</html>

HTML 태그의 종류

HTML 태그는 크게 구조 태그, 텍스트 관련 태그, 목록 태그, 링크 태그 등으로 나눌 수 있습니다. 각 태그는 고유한 기능을 가지고 있으며 적절한 사용이 중요합니다.

1. 구조 태그

구조 태그는 웹 페이지의 레이아웃을 정의하는 데 사용됩니다. 주요 구조 태그로는 <header>, <nav>, <main>, <section>, <article>, <footer>가 있습니다.

  • <header> : 페이지 상단의 머리글로, 주로 로고와 탐색 링크를 포함합니다.
  • <nav> : 사이트 내의 탐색 링크를 정의하며, 사용자들이 원하는 정보를 쉽게 찾아갈 수 있도록 도와줍니다.
  • <main> : 웹 페이지의 주요 콘텐츠를 표시하는 부분을 나타냅니다. 각 문서당 하나만 존재해야 합니다.
  • <section> : 문서의 특정 주제를 가진 섹션을 정의합니다. 관련된 콘텐츠를 그룹화할 때 유용합니다.
  • <article> : 독립적인 콘텐츠를 정의하는 태그로, 블로그 글이나 뉴스 기사가 이에 해당합니다.
  • <footer> : 문서의 하단에 위치하며, 작성자 정보나 연락처, 저작권 등의 정보를 포함합니다.

2. 텍스트 관련 태그

텍스트 관련 태그는 문단 및 텍스트 포맷을 정의합니다. 주요 태그로는 <p> (문단), <h1>부터 <h6>까지의 제목 태그, <strong> (강조체), <em> (이탤릭체), <small> (작은 글씨) 등이 있습니다.

  • <p> : 문단을 정의하며, 기본적으로 줄 바꿈 효과가 있어 내용을 구분합니다.
  • <h1> ~ <h6> : 제목을 표현하며, 숫자가 작을수록 글자의 크기가 커집니다. 웹 페이지에서 중요한 내용을 명확히 전달할 수 있습니다.
  • <strong> : 강한 강조를 나타내는 태그로, 일반적으로 굵은 글씨로 표현됩니다.
  • <em> : 이탤릭체로 표현되는 강조 태그로, 문맥을 강조하는 데 사용됩니다.

3. 목록 태그

HTML에서는 목록을 만들기 위한 여러 태그가 제공됩니다. 주로 <ul> (순서 없는 목록)과 <ol> (순서 있는 목록), 그리고 <li> (목록 항목) 태그가 사용됩니다.

  • <ul> : 항목들이 순서 없이 나열됩니다.
  • <ol> : 항목들이 숫자로 순서가 매겨져 나열됩니다.
  • <li> : 목록 항목을 정의합니다.

4. 링크 및 기타 태그

링크를 생성하기 위한 태그는 <a>로, 다른 웹 페이지나 리소스로 연결할 때 사용됩니다. 이 외에도 이미지 태그 <img>, 줄 바꿈 태그 <br>, 입력 태그 <input> 등이 있습니다.

  • <a> : 하이퍼링크를 생성하며, href 속성을 통해 URL을 연결합니다.
  • <img> : 이미지를 웹 페이지에 삽입합니다. alt 속성으로 이미지에 대한 설명을 추가하여 접근성을 높일 수 있습니다.
  • <br> : 줄 바꿈을 추가하는 태그로, 텍스트 구분이나 간격 조절에 유용합니다.
  • <input> : 사용자 입력을 받기 위한 다양한 형태의 입력 필드를 생성합니다.

HTML 태그 사용 시 유의사항

HTML 태그를 사용할 때 몇 가지 유의해야 할 사항이 있습니다. 올바른 요소를 사용하는 것이 중요한데, 이는 콘텐츠의 의미를 명확하게 전달하고, 와 웹 접근성을 향상시키는 데 도움이 됩니다. 또한, 태그는 논리적으로 중첩되어야 하며 적절한 계층 구조를 유지해야 합니다.

정리하자면, HTML은 웹 페이지의 기본적인 설계와 콘텐츠 프레젠테이션에 필수적입니다. 다양한 태그를 올바로 활용하여 구조적이고 의미 있는 웹 페이지를 구축하는 것이 매우 중요합니다. 이러한 기술들을 통해 사용자 경험을 개선하고 정보의 전달력을 높일 수 있습니다. HTML을 잘 이해하고 활용하는 것이 성공적인 웹 개발의 첫걸음이라 할 수 있습니다.


자주 물으시는 질문

HTML 태그란 무엇인가요?

HTML 태그는 웹 페이지를 구성하는 기본적인 요소로, 내용을 구조적으로 표시하는 역할을 합니다. 이 태그를 통해 텍스트, 이미지 등 다양한 요소를 웹에 표현할 수 있습니다.

HTML의 구조는 어떻게 되나요?

HTML 문서는 보통 <html>, <head>, <body> 세 가지 주요 부분으로 나뉘며, 각 부분은 웹 페이지의 메타정보와 내용을 포함합니다.

어떤 종류의 HTML 태그가 있나요?

HTML 태그는 다양한 카테고리로 나누어지며, 구조 태그, 텍스트 관련 태그, 목록 태그, 링크 태그 등이 대표적입니다. 각 태그는 특정한 목적과 기능을 가지고 있습니다.

Leave a Comment